The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ana (PMAY), a flagship housing scheme launched by the Government of India, remains a focal point of developmental discourse as it balances large-scale urban infrastructure success with localized administrative oversight issues. Recent reports from various regions illustrate the complex reality of this nationwide project.

Urban Progress in Ghaziabad

In a significant development for urban housing, the city of Ghaziabad is nearing the completion of a major phase under the PMAY-Urban vertical. Authorities have confirmed that approximately 10,000 housing units are now in the final stages of construction. These flats are designed to provide affordable living spaces for thousands of families who have long awaited the fulfillment of their dream of homeownership. Officials indicated that the administrative process for the handover is accelerating, with beneficiaries expected to receive possession of their new homes in the coming months. This milestone is being hailed as a major boost for urban middle-class and low-income families looking for structured, government-supported housing solutions.

Administrative Accountability in Garhwa

While urban centers see rapid progress, district-level administration remains under scrutiny. In Garhwa, the District Magistrate (DM) recently conducted a comprehensive inspection of block offices and local health centers. During these proceedings, the administration expressed deep dissatisfaction regarding the slow pace of PMAY implementation. The findings revealed that targets were not being met on schedule, leading to the issuance of show-cause notices to responsible local officials. This highlights the government's rigorous approach to ensuring that central directives are executed with efficiency at the grassroots level.

Challenges in Chamoli

In addition to project timelines, the transparency of the scheme remains a critical priority. In the Chamoli district, particularly in the village of Beradhar, residents have formally raised concerns regarding alleged irregularities within the selection and execution process of the PMAY. These grievances involve disputes over beneficiary eligibility and the distribution of funds. Such complaints underscore the necessity for continued vigilance and local-level monitoring to ensure that the benefits of the scheme reach the intended underprivileged populations without the interference of administrative mismanagement or corruption.
